"Penguins Dominate Capitals in Season Opener, Shutout Victory"

TL;DR Summary
The Washington Capitals suffered a 4-0 defeat to the Pittsburgh Penguins in their season opener, with Evgeni Malkin, Sidney Crosby, and Reilly Smith scoring for the Penguins. Despite the loss, there were positive signs for the Capitals, including improved performances from Nicklas Backstrom and Alex Ovechkin. Connor McMichael showed promise, while Rasmus Sandin had some unfortunate plays. The Capitals' power play struggled, and there are still adjustments to be made with the team's new additions and coaching changes. Overall, it's early in the season, and there's room for improvement.
